Wood India Consulting division is currently recruiting for an Engineering Manager - Process to join the team focusing on subsea projects within our Technical Consulting Division.

This position is based in Chennai and because success in the role will require in-person contact with the team, remote work is not an option.

Our Clients and Projects

Designing the future. Transforming the world.

Within Technical Consulting, our clients range from both major and independent operators of onshore oil & gas and clean energy facilities such as carbon capture, utilisation and storage (CCUS) and windfarms, through to suppliers, fabricators and EPC contractors.

We execute projects from concept through detailed design, construction and commissioning on a world-wide basis. We are proud to be working on projects that support the energy transition journey, enabling a more sustainable future for us all.

The Technical Consulting business line executes feasibility and concept studies across upstream Oil & Gas, Gas Processing, Refinery, Petrochemicals & Chemicals, Biofuels / Fuel Substitutes, Fertilisers and Decarbonisation projects.
  • As a Manager, you will provide technical direction and technology expertise within Technical Consulting and the wider Wood organisation relating to the preparation of proposals and execution of studies and projects relating to oil & gas, refinery, petrochemicals, etc.
  • Focusing on technical project delivery you will be a key member across project teams to develop the technoeconomic solution that guides your client to successfully achieve the next stage in their decision gate process.
  • You will interface with a multi-disciplinary team of highly capable SME’s and Consultants to deliver best in class solutions that will ensure high customer satisfaction.
  • As an SME you will also have the opportunity to share your knowledge and support with the development and mentoring of less experienced engineers and consultants. Through this you will support your own personal growth and that of our Consulting business as we deliver solutions to a growing world.

The key objectives for this role are:

  • Execute and provide technical support to projects within Wood's Technical Consulting group.
  • Involved in conceptual and feasibility studies, optimization work, and pre-FEED stages, including techno-economic analysis and licensors selection.
  • Work closely with customers to understand their needs and produce designs and services to meet these needs.
  • Be flexible, supporting several studies at the same time without missing milestones.
  • Coach and mentor less experienced staff.
  • Identify issues and propose solutions using innovative and novel solutions, plus ability to grasp unfamiliar concepts.
  • Ensure that the process team assigned on various studies Complete technical design work to a high standard without supervision using Wood's and Client design methods, standards and data.
  • Encourage the team members to Grow in leadership qualities and capability providing optimised solutions to Client’s complex multi-faceted problems; articulating these in a way that allows Clients to readily present to their own internal and external stakeholders.
  • Develop compelling and competitive proposals that readily demonstrate to Clients the best way to deliver their project.
  • Challenge the status quo, support and be part of an award-winning group that seeks to grow and develop to be the best it can be.
  • Be a role model for Wood’s behaviors; encouraging a collaborative, inclusive and supportive team that can have fun and enjoy the work we deliver.

Expected:

  • A credible expert in the oil & gas, refinery, petrochemicals field and recognised as such within the industry.
  • Up-to-date technical expertise in a range of upstream oil & gas production, gas processing, refinery units, petrochemicals technologies, e.g. steam cracker and derivatives, methane derivatives value chain, biochemicals, as well as ideally having experience in configuration studies and/or decarbonisation studies.
  • Has worked on a range of studies across different markets and understands the tools used and levels of detail required to support the early phase decision making process.
  • Excellent analytical and conceptual thinking skills, ability to manage own work and the work of others, plus a strong customer focus and team-working skills.
  • Readily adaptable with excellent communication skills
  • Ability to analyse logical problems or problems with several obvious relationships, systematically break a complex task into more manageable parts and identify the critical components of a problem.
  • Support Delivery Manager to Manage a team of wide range of experienced Process Engineers and Graduates and to enhance the billability.
  • Lead the recruitment drive in Process & Chemicals team to meet the annual target set for GEC.
  • Engage with Wood global offices in all geographic locations to identify the workshare opportunities for GEC, plan suitable resources for potential opportunities and also provide inputs to the P&C proposal activities being executed in global offices.
  • Identify training needs of the team, arrange suitable training sessions and focus on skill development of the team.
  • Commercial awareness of Project Delivery
  • Foster the Quality Assurance / Quality Control aspects in the team.
  • Chemical Engineering Degree with minimum 20 years of experience.

Desirable:

  • Prior experience working with International as well as Domestic Customers
  • Experience of managing a team of process engineers preferably in the capacity of Department Head or manager in Consulting or relevant industry.
  • Experience in FEED, EPC, Commissioning and / or Operations such that Clients recognize the experience from later phases being considered in their early project phase.
